A Summary of Metal Polishing - In most cases, metal polishing is desirable for a pleasing appearance and for clean-room applications. It is one of the most popular treatments because of its use in intensifying the original attractiveness of the items, for example, kitchenware, auto parts or motorcycle parts. Similarly, a great many clean-rooms will require a polished finish in order to decrease the permeability of the metal surfaces that will cause particles to collect and contaminate. A really good example of this practice might be in a vacuum chamber.

You'll discover a large number of strategies to finish metal, and let us take a review of several of the methods involved. Various metals can be burnished chemically, electromechanically, using specialized buffing machines, or even manually. A special finishing paste or compound is frequently utilised, which could contain a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, due to its weak thermal conductivity, fairly high viscidness, and hardness is among the most time-consuming. On the contrary, merchandise made from non-ferrous metals tend to be receptive to buffing, as these need the least amount of operations.

A slower pad speed is commonly employed any time a high quality mirror finish is imperative. Polishing buffs covered in paste are greatly affected by specific pressure on the p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face might be elevated to a precise range, having said that, going over the most effective measure of load not simply reduces the quality level of the procedure, but also can worsen effectiveness, might cause wear to the component, and there is moreover a significant heating up of the pieces being worked on, because of friction. When you are working on thin metal, it will be increased temperature (and the subsequent pliancy of the material) that can induce components to twist, flex, or bend. In general, it takes a talented technician to take into account all these things to equally not cause harm to the workpiece and to work successfully. For you to appreciably boost the quality of the resultant surface area, the buffing procedure really should be performed with a lesser amount of aggression and not so much force in order to finally deliver a surface without scores or fine lines caused by the buffing procedure, subsequently ar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
